Memorandum Order
This matter was referred to Magistrate Judge Keith A.
Pesto for pretrial proceedings in accordance with the Magistrates
Act, 28 U.S.C.§ 636 and Local Rule 72 for Magistrate Judges.
The Magistrate Judge filed a Report and Recommendation

The plaintiff was notified that pursuant to 28 U.S.C.§
636(b) (1), he had fourteen days to file written objections to the
Report and Recommendation.
Plaintiff has not filed objections and
the time to do so has expired.
